Output 8246e0fe12b32d8917d43a0f9aeecfcf2cc3ce34638448e7e161db173266f39f:7

value
22840000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40380d34bd78c6c936c59a9cfb9dcd707bf95305 OP_EQUALVERIFY OP_CHECKSIG
address
16rZPoxZAopKo51EYWSvvz7MtPKShDCK74
transaction
8246e0fe12b32d8917d43a0f9aeecfcf2cc3ce34638448e7e161db173266f39f
spent
true